gprMax中任意不规则形状三维建模与模拟gprMax中给出了不规则几何形状的建模方法。常规的几何建模都是基于gprMax内置的几何命令建模,所建立的模型是规则的,如圆球、正方体、圆柱体、三角体等。不规则形状三维建模需要利用matlab或者python生成三维数组,然后将三维数组保存到HDF5格式文件中,因此,需要利用matlab编程生成任意不规则三维数组。本帖子给出一个生成任意不规则形状的代码。
之前我们介绍过简单的把物体压平到投影平面来制造阴影。但这种阴影方式有其局限性(如投影平面须是平面)。在OpenGL1.4引入了一种新的方法阴影贴图来产生阴影。阴影贴图背后的原理是简单的。我们先把光源的位置当作照相机的位置,我们从这个位置观察物体,我们就知道哪些物体的表面是被照射到(被光源看到)的,哪些是没有被照射到(被遮挡住)的(在某个方向上离光源最近的表面是被照射的,后面的表面则没有被照射到
1 手镯手机 这款手机的名字为“Bracelet”,外表与精巧的手镯无异,除了打电话、收发短信以外,还内建了Mp3功能。尤其是钻石般晶莹华贵的按键,颇为吸引人。 2 益智魔方 据说CUin5概念手机的创意是源自益智玩具魔方,方方正正模块的设计还是非常抢眼的。遍布在CUin5概念手机周身的都是按键,*、#和0-9共12个按键多达8组,机身的正反两面各搭载2组,
转载
2023-10-18 09:29:57
85阅读
# Python 随机裁剪不规则形状的实现指南
在计算机视觉和图像处理领域,有时我们需要从图像中随机裁剪出不规则形状的区域。这种需求在图像增强、数据集构建等场景中非常常见。本文将指导你如何使用 Python 实现这一功能,详解每一步的代码和流程。
## 整体流程
为了实现随机裁剪不规则形状,我们可以遵循以下步骤:
| 步骤 | 描述
原创
2024-09-02 05:27:40
284阅读
“ 通过矢量图层裁剪遥感栅格数据,就可以得到我们的感兴趣区,需要用到掩膜、矢量栅格化等知识。”今天的遥感之美封面图—国家公园雅乌河, 热带雨林亚马逊。那里有各种各样的生物资源,也有让人流连忘返的热带雨林风光,还有各种值得研究的自然现象。不如咱们现在就通过遥感图像一睹为快吧!公园的名字来自于河流中一种名为"雅乌"的鱼类,这种鱼个头肥大,而且肉质鲜美,是当地人酷爱的佳肴。而且公园内最大的一条
图像裁剪的目的是将研究之外的区域去除,常用的是按照行政区划边界或自然区划边界进行图像的裁剪,在基础数据生产中,还经常要做标准分幅裁剪。按照ENVI的图像裁剪过程,可分为规则裁剪和不规则裁剪。ENVI5.6之前版本的图像裁剪工具为Subset Data from ROIs工具,之后的版本把这个工具移除了,使用另外一种工具进行裁剪,本文介绍ENVI5.6.3(中文版)中图像裁剪方法,其实操作过程也是非
转载
2023-07-25 20:03:52
274阅读
虽然华为目前面临着非常大的困境,但是无论怎么说,自己的产品线还是要继续经营下去的,尤其是自家的两大旗舰系列——mate系列和P系列。按照华为的规律,P系列主打上半年旗舰,而mate系列则是主打下半年的旗舰,最近外媒曝光了一份疑似华为P50新一代旗舰手机的渲染图,这份渲染图在暗示,华为P50将要给我们一个惊喜,一起来看看吧! 首先我们可以看到,华为P50的后置摄像头模组采用的是一个不规则
转载
2023-07-30 20:31:50
198阅读
定义结构元素形态学处理的核心就是定义结构元素,在OpenCV-Python中,可以使用其自带的getStructuringElement函数,也可以直接使用NumPy的ndarray来定义一个结构元素。可以定义椭圆、矩形、十字形等形态学结构:椭圆:cv2.getStructuringElement(cv2.MORPH_ELLIPSE,(5,5))矩形:cv2.getStructuringEleme
转载
2023-09-18 10:48:05
145阅读
效果图:操作步骤:步骤1:打开PS,新建一个800600的画布。给画布填充颜色:#f2f3f5。在画布中间建一个尺寸为710452的矩形;填充颜色:#ffffff。步骤2:画一个48*300的矩形,填充渐变色:#58adfe~#98d6ff叫,角度60。添加投影:#0080ff,不透明度30%,角度90,距离8,大小12。然后将矩形旋转40度,放在画布右下角。步骤3:画一个154154的正圆,填充
# 安卓不规则形状显示的探索
随着移动设备应用程序的不断发展,用户对界面美观度和交互体验的要求也越来越高。在Android平台上,开发者不仅要创建常规的矩形视图,还需要展示各种不规则形状的视图来提升用户体验。本文将探讨如何在Android中实现不规则形状的显示,并提供相关代码示例。
## 不规则形状的实现方式
在Android中,创建不规则形状的视图主要有两种方法:自定义View和使用Pat
经常会在移动应用中看到类似下图的各种图片:这样的图形在Android上要怎么实现呢?在Android系统中,目前主要有三种方式可以实现上图的形状,下面一一介绍。一、PorterDuffXfermode方式之前的博客曾经介绍过用这种方式画圆形头像,实际上,它不仅可以用来画圆形头像,还可以实现任意形状。首先来复习一下16中效果:1.PorterDuff.Mode.CLEAR 所绘制不会提交到画布
转载
2023-11-08 20:54:07
25阅读
opencv基础学习 小知识--绘图函数+小实战训练声明:这里是本人自学opencv时写下来的笔记。同时参考并感谢up主【致敬大神】。在她视频基础进行修改加上自己理解补充。目的是为了更好的进步与学习。如有更多学习经验和知识分享,欢迎评论,谢谢。 1、学习目标学习opencv画图直线、圆、椭圆、矩形、不规则图形。函数:cv.line()、cv.circle()、cv.rectangle()、cv
转载
2024-03-14 08:05:04
325阅读
实验十三 轮廓形状分析实验一、实验目的和要求二、实验内容三、实验仪器、设备四、实验原理五、实验步骤六、实验注意事项七、实验结果八、实验总结 一、实验目的和要求 理解轮廓形状分析的基本原理;掌握实现轮廓形状分析的代码编写方法。二、实验内容 (一)新建工程; (二)在Vs2015中配置OpenCV; (三)得到原图的灰度图像并进行平滑; (四)使用Threshold检测边缘; (
转载
2024-02-18 11:58:41
174阅读
前言 1.实现效果2.实现原理2.1 边框圆角渐变色我们都知道,实现一个边框渐变色可以用border-image,但是border-image不支持圆角;border-image: border-image CSS 属性允许在元素的边框上绘制图像。这使得绘制复杂的外观组件更加简单,也不用在某些情况下使用九宫格了。使用 border-image 时,其将会替换掉border-style 属性所设置的
转载
2023-12-19 11:32:16
325阅读
文章目录魔棒工具----适用分界线比较明显内容快速选区快速选择工具---适合:根据色差快速增加或者减少选区套索/磁性套索/多边形套索 工具---手动进行边界引导的选取工具通道转选区抠图---选择明暗关系强烈的图通道进行选区转化 最近写文档需要用到一些图片,需要使用到ps进行抠图,总结一下抠图技巧 魔棒工具----适用分界线比较明显内容快速选区魔棒介绍:photoshop中的常用工具用来建立不规
图像ROI与ROI操作图像的ROI(region of interest)是指图像中感兴趣区域、在OpenCV中图像设置图像ROI区域,实现只对ROI区域操作。矩形ROI区域提取矩形ROI区域copy不规则ROI区域ROI区域mask生成像素位 and操作提取到ROI区域加背景or操作add 背景与ROI区域获取规则ROI区域h,w=src.shape[:2]
#获取ROI
cx=w//2
cy=
转载
2024-10-26 07:49:14
42阅读
四步骤实现不规则形状目录四步骤实现不规则形状一:创建 div 类名 round二:给 round 添加 CSS 样式三:创建 Change 按钮类名四:给 Change 添加 CSS 样式五:增加 JavaScript 逻辑☞ 动态聊天输入框高度调节一:创建 div 类名 round首先,我们需要创建一个 div 元素,并为它设置一个类名 round。这个 div 将作为我们变换形状的基础。<
不规则形状的Mask动画 效果 源码 https://github.com/YouXianMing/Animations 细节
转载
2016-07-10 14:04:00
177阅读
2评论
在 iOS 开发中,绘制不规则的形状可以通过 Core Graphics 框架实现。从基础的圆形、矩形,到复杂的多边形,我们可以使用 Quartz 2D 提供的绘图 API。这篇博文将深入探讨如何使用 iOS 的技术来绘制不规则形状,并通过分层的步骤帮助你理解其实现过程。
## 协议背景
在处理图形绘制时,理解协议的演变对提高效率至关重要。Core Graphics 是一个低级别图形 API,
基础技能1 - 神奇的border我们先来画一个长方形: .Rectangle
{
height: 100px;
width: 200px;
background: darkgray;
border-width: 50px;
border-style: solid;
border-top-color: cyan;
border-
转载
2023-12-06 18:58:40
190阅读